1 Quando Sambalate soube que estávamos reconstruindo o muro, ficou furioso. Ridicularizou os judeus

2 e, na presença de seus compatriotas e dos poderosos de Samaria, disse: "O que aqueles frágeis judeus estão fazendo? Será que vão restaurar o seu muro? Irão oferecer sacrifícios? Irão terminar a obra num só dia? Será que vão conseguir ressuscitar pedras de construção daqueles montes de entulho e de pedras queimadas? "

3 Tobias, o amonita, que estava ao seu lado, completou: "Pois que construam! Basta que uma raposa suba lá, para que esse muro de pedras desabe! "

1 But it came to pass, when Sanballat heard that we were building the wall, it angered him, and he was greatly displeased,and mocked the Jews;

2 and spake before his brethren, and the army of Samaria, and said, What are, these feeble Jews, doing? will they fortify themselves? will they sacrifice? will they make an end in a day? will they bring to life the stones out of the heaps of dust, when, they, have been burned up?

3 Now, Tobiah the Ammonite, was beside him,so he said, Even that which they are building, if a fox should go up, he would break down their stone wall!
